Transaction 150f9241b94876619d8c747897ad108371cf6ca2393947b1adce58bc0ba29e67
1 Input
1 Output
-
150f9241b94876619d8c747897ad108371cf6ca2393947b1adce58bc0ba29e67:0
- value
- 2584258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5721c719dcaf5fb3ca2524ac5546f95f38c67d1 OP_EQUAL
- address
- 3NcDN3xKwpYWwfCUMpz46ZFdsrrtpMubGa